JSON Parser
Syntax
$input.parseJson()
Beschreibung
Interpretiert die Eingabe als JSON formattierten Text und dekodiert daraus ein Wörterbuch.
Parameter
Name | Typ | Beschreibung | Pflicht | Default |
---|---|---|---|---|
input | Zeichenkette/Binärwert | Text im JSON-Format | ja | - |
Rückgabewert
Typ: Wörterbuch, Liste, Zeichenkette, Zahl, Wahrheitswert
Das aus der JSON-Eingabe rekonstruierte strukturierte Objekt.
Beispiele
Beispiel 1
"{foo: 3, bar: true}".parseJson()["foo"]
Ausgabe: 3
Der Aufruf von parseJson()
liefert das Wörterbuch mit den Einträgen "foo"
und "bar"
. Von diesem Wörterbuch wird der Wert des Eintrags mit dem Schlüssel "foo"
geliefert, also der Wert 3
.
Beispiel 2
"47".parseJson() + 2
Ausgabe: 49
Interpretiert die Zeichenkette "47"
als Zahl 47
und addiert 2
. Beachte: Der Ausdruck "47" + 2
würde die Zeichenkette "472"
liefern!